Tender Title: Supply of 250 MM OD HDPE Pipes
Reference Number: GEM/2025/B/6109585
Issuing Authority/Department: Materials Management, Ministry of Coal
Scope of Work and Objectives
The objective of this tender is to solicit bids for the supply of 250 MM OD HDPE pipes, specifically made from PE100 material, conforming to the specifications of PN 6 as per IS 4984:1995. The total quantity required for this procurement is 518 units, with each pipe being 10 meters in length. The pipes are critical for various applications within the ministry's projects and infrastructure.
Eligibility Criteria
To qualify for this tender, bidders must meet the following eligibility requirements:
- Must be a registered entity with the appropriate licenses and permits.
- Companies must demonstrate prior experience in supplying similar HDPE piping systems.
- Compliance with local and national industry standards is mandatory.
Technical Requirements
Bidders must ensure that the supplied pipes meet the following technical specifications:
- Material: PE100
- Diameter: 250 MM OD
- Pressure Rating: PN 6
- Length: 10 meters
- Additional requirements include both side slip-on flanges for a complete installation setup.
